Typical incomes

Median personal, family and household incomes.

Typical weekly pay is much higher here than in most areas. Households usually earn $2,083 a week, while the typical person earns $1,124, both of which are well above the national figures.

Income spread

High earners and the full distribution.

Despite high typical earnings, no one in the area earns $2,000 or more per week, a figure far below the Australian average of 12.5%. Instead, the population is split evenly between those earning under $650 and those earning between $1,500 and $2,999.
